Utwórz wypełniony obiekt prostokątny w pliku PDF za pomocą języka Java
Wprowadzenie do tworzenia wypełnionego obiektu prostokątnego w formacie PDF przy użyciu języka Java
W tym samouczku pokażemy, jak utworzyć wypełniony obiekt prostokątny w dokumencie PDF przy użyciu języka Java z pomocą Aspose.PDF dla języka Java. Wypełnione prostokąty są powszechnie używane w plikach PDF do różnych celów, takich jak wyróżnianie ważnych informacji lub tworzenie wizualnych separacji.
Wymagania wstępne
Zanim zaczniemy, upewnij się, że spełnione są następujące wymagania wstępne:
- Zainstalowano Java Development Kit (JDK)
- Zintegrowane środowisko programistyczne (IDE), takie jak Eclipse lub IntelliJ
- Aspose.PDF dla biblioteki Java pobranej i skonfigurowanej
Konfigurowanie Aspose.PDF dla Java
Aby rozpocząć, musisz pobrać Aspose.PDF dla Java ze strony internetowej. Wykonaj następujące kroki:
Uzyskaj dostęp do dokumentacji Aspose.PDF dla języka Java pod adresemTutaj.
Pobierz bibliotekę i postępuj zgodnie z wyświetlanymi instrukcjami instalacji.
Zaimportuj bibliotekę Aspose.PDF do swojego projektu Java.
Teraz, gdy skonfigurowaliśmy Aspose.PDF dla języka Java, możemy przejść do tworzenia wypełnionego prostokąta w dokumencie PDF.
Tworzenie nowego dokumentu PDF
W tej sekcji utworzymy nowy dokument PDF przy użyciu Aspose.PDF dla Java. Najpierw zaimportuj niezbędne klasy:
import com.aspose.pdf.Document;
import com.aspose.pdf.Page;
import com.aspose.pdf.Rectangle;
Następnie utwórz nowy dokument i stronę:
Document pdfDocument = new Document();
Page page = pdfDocument.getPages().add();
Dodawanie wypełnionego prostokąta
Aby dodać wypełniony prostokąt, musisz zdefiniować jego współrzędne, wymiary i kolor. Oto przykład, jak utworzyć wypełniony prostokąt:
Rectangle filledRectangle = new Rectangle(page, 100, 100, 200, 50);
filledRectangle.setBackgroundColor(com.aspose.pdf.Color.getRed());
page.getParagraphs().add(filledRectangle);
W tym kodzie:
- Tworzymy nowy
Rectangle
obiekt, określając jego położenie (x=100, y=100), szerokość (200) i wysokość (50). - Ustawiamy kolor tła prostokąta na czerwony.
- Na koniec dodajemy prostokąt do strony.
Dostosowywanie prostokąta
Możesz dostosować prostokąt dalej, zmieniając jego kolor, obramowanie lub inne właściwości. Zapoznaj się z dokumentacją Aspose.PDF for Java, aby uzyskać więcej opcji.
Zapisywanie pliku PDF
Po utworzeniu dokumentu PDF z wypełnionym prostokątem zapisz go do pliku:
pdfDocument.save("FilledRectangle.pdf");
Uruchamianie kodu
Skompiluj i uruchom swój kod Java. Powinieneś teraz mieć plik PDF o nazwie „FilledRectangle.pdf” z wypełnionym prostokątem.
Wniosek
W tym samouczku nauczyliśmy się, jak utworzyć wypełniony obiekt prostokątny w dokumencie PDF przy użyciu Javy i Aspose.PDF dla Javy. Może to być przydatne do wyróżniania ważnych informacji lub dodawania elementów wizualnych do plików PDF. Aspose.PDF dla Javy zapewnia potężny i elastyczny sposób pracy z plikami PDF w aplikacjach Java.
Najczęściej zadawane pytania
Czym jest Aspose.PDF dla Java?
Aspose.PDF for Java to biblioteka Java, która umożliwia programistom pracę z plikami PDF w aplikacjach Java. Zapewnia szeroki zakres funkcji do tworzenia, manipulowania i zarządzania dokumentami PDF.
Jak zainstalować Aspose.PDF dla Java?
Możesz zainstalować Aspose.PDF dla Java, pobierając bibliotekę ze strony internetowej Aspose i postępując zgodnie z instrukcjami instalacji zawartymi w dokumentacji.
Czy mogę zmienić kolor wypełnionego prostokąta?
Tak, możesz dostosować kolor wypełnionego prostokąta, ustawiając kolor jego tła za pomocąsetBackgroundColor
metodą, jak pokazano w samouczku.
Czy Aspose.PDF dla Java jest darmowy?
Aspose.PDF for Java jest biblioteką komercyjną i może być konieczne zakupienie licencji, aby używać jej w swoich projektach. Sprawdź stronę internetową Aspose, aby uzyskać szczegóły dotyczące licencjonowania.
Gdzie mogę znaleźć więcej przykładów wykorzystania Aspose.PDF w Javie?
Więcej przykładów i szczegółową dokumentację dotyczącą korzystania z Aspose.PDF dla języka Java można znaleźć na stronie internetowej Aspose pod adresemTutaj.